A remark on a helicopter and submarine game

Andrej Y U. Garnaev

Naval Research Logistics (NRL), 1993, vol. 40, issue 5, 745-753

Abstract: The article considers a two‐person zero‐sum game in which the movement of the players is constrained to integer points …, −1, 0, 1, … of a line L. Initially the searcher (hider) is at point x = 0 (x = d, d > 0). The searcher and the hider perform simple motion on L with maximum speeds w and u, respectively, where w > u > 0. Each of the players knows the other's initial position but not the other's subsequent positions. The searcher has a bomb which he can drop at any time during his search. Between the dropping of the bomb and the bomb exploding there is a T time lag.
